Revolutionizing Road Paving
Every driver knows the unpleasant scent of asphalt. This ubiquitous material covers our roads but poses environmental challenges. Each year, the U.S. consumes around 400 million tons of asphalt for road maintenance and construction. This reliance on petroleum leads to air pollution and increases our carbon footprint. In a significant shift, Verde Resources, based in St. Louis, uses forest waste as an alternative to traditional asphalt. By eliminating petroleum, they not only reduce harmful emissions but also create a more sustainable paving solution. This innovative approach could transform how we think about road construction.
A Roadmap to Sustainability
Verde’s method offers practical benefits. First, using forest waste helps recycle materials that might otherwise contribute to deforestation. Second, a more eco-friendly process reduces the unpleasant odors associated with roadwork. If widely adopted, this could change the dynamics of construction sites across urban areas. Reducing harmful emissions aligns with broader environmental goals and enhances community well-being. As the demand for sustainable practices grows, solutions like Verde’s pave the way for a cleaner future. The success of this initiative holds promise for other industries, underscoring a crucial shift in how we approach infrastructure while addressing climate change.
